Truth be told (bad teachers aside) my experience probably would have been different if I knew for sure what I wanted to do, and could have commuted to school without having to rely on a transit system established in 71.Originally Posted by Tracy
Using Marta to get around Atlanta, while carrying 15K worth of camera **** loaned to you by the school, was a bit of a scary experience.
Unfortunately I found the teachers to be average, and couldn't really do photography assignments with a suspended drivers license. My major just happened to be one that you really needed to have your own car to get the results needed.
It's great if you know what you're there for, and you know what you want, but an art school isn't a good place to start college if you not totally sure what you want to do. A lot of the classes are so specific that a lot of them won't transfer to other schools.
No arguing though, the school did make me a better photographer. I just realized too little too late, that I wasn't really sure I wanted to be one.
